“Sheet metal brake” can mean very different equipment in procurement conversations. For metal roofing equipment hire, most rental availability in and around Milwaukee is the portable siding/trim brake category (Tapco PRO series, Van Mark Trim-A-Brake, and equivalents). These units are designed around coil stock and light-gauge sheet for building envelope trim. Example published specs in this class include throat depths around 14 inches, mouth openings around 2-3/8 inches, and capacities such as galvanized steel up to 28 ga and soft aluminum up to .030—which is generally aligned to typical fascia/edge/transition flashing work, not heavier architectural sheet or plate. If your scope includes heavier gauge stainless, thick copper, or structural fabrication, it is often more cost-effective to outsource bends to a sheet metal shop rather than try to “rent a bigger brake,” because true press brakes are rarely available as short-term rentals and require material handling and operator controls beyond what most roof crews plan for.
Confirm these items on the reservation call / PO line: (1) working length (10’, 10’6”, 12’, 14’), (2) gauge capacity for your material (26 ga vs 24 ga; painted steel vs galvanized), (3) whether the brake includes a stand/legs, (4) whether a cutoff tool (e.g., pro cutter) and uncoiler/coil holder are included or are adders, and (5) transport requirements (pickup truck vs trailer; tie-down points; protective packaging).

Important: if you think you only need “half a day,” validate the billing clock. Many rental policies charge for time out, not time used, and define “day” as 24 hours, “week” as 7 consecutive days, and “month” as 4 consecutive weeks (28 days).(m

Once you move beyond a single punch-list rental, the best savings on sheet metal brake equipment hire costs in Milwaukee come from managing time-out, avoiding avoidable backcharges, and aligning rental terms to how roof work actually flows (weather delays, inspections, and sequencing with other trades). The goal is not to “find a cheaper day rate,” but to reduce the number of billable days that produce no trim output.
If your crew only fabricates trim on two specific days, avoid having the brake sit idle on the ground for “just in case.” In Milwaukee, wind and rain days can stall metal roofing production; if the brake is already on rent, those days still bill.
Self-haul can reduce hard costs but often adds soft costs. A two-person crew loading, transporting, and setting a brake can burn 1.5–3.0 labor hours between yard time, straps, and jobsite staging. If your labor burden is high, delivery may actually be the cheaper total-cost option.
On metal roofing jobs, the brake without a cutoff tool and coil management can become the bottleneck. If trim output is the critical path, paying accessory adders is often cheaper than paying extra days of base rent.
Milwaukee’s winter conditions and lakefront humidity accelerate corrosion on small metal components and can stiffen moving parts when equipment is stored in unheated conditions. While this is not always billed as a separate fee, it increases the probability of damage claims and downtime.
